Output 95ec67ed311680e02ddd94dd27e28e599c46b99bbff474d3a9fc16cd5d009bb7:7

value
46966530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4b0d9e24ef24a2a60c38473df8f42716f866c59 OP_EQUAL
address
MTHmLvpYCUKAuaH7bD76BUCfyf2ZQJTqZ3
transaction
95ec67ed311680e02ddd94dd27e28e599c46b99bbff474d3a9fc16cd5d009bb7
spent
true